96,000

One of the best ensemble numbers from "In the Heights", 96,000 has the same hip-hop/dance-pop combination that makes Lin-Manuel Miranda's music so unique--AND it actually works outside of the context of the show itself. There are solo opportunities for 2 rappers, one tenor, and one soprano. Also, this chart can accommodate a complete costume change, with the SA entering at 1:10 and the TB leaving for the next minute through the "lottery" solo.

Instrumentation: Piano/Bass/Drums/Percussion/Guitar/Synth/Tpts 1 & 2/Trombone 1 & 2/Alto & Tenor Sax
